Properly estimating and prioritizing project requirements is critical to Agile project planning success. You need to be able to map out the work necessary for your product release.

In this course, you'll learn about critical Agile planning activities, including creating personas and wireframing. This course also covers the most common Agile estimation techniques such as story points, wideband Delphi and affinity estimation. This course also covers requirements prioritization methods and activities you perform when completing your release plan. Learning Objectives:

Upon completion of this course, you will be able to:

  • Distinguish between the key tasks of release planning and iteration planning
  • Identify best practices for creating personas as part of requirements definition
  • Identify wireframing best practices for formatting user stories
  • Identify benefits of story mapping
  • Recognize Agile estimating techniques
  • Identify considerations to keep in mind when estimating team velocity
  • Distinguish between the different customer-valued prioritization methods
  • Identify the four MoSCoW model categories
  • Distinguish between characteristics of the Kano model and priority matrices
  • Identify the key activities that take place in the iteration planning meeting
  • Demonstrate your knowledge of Agile planning activities
